Shares of Golden Entertainment (GDEN) are soaring 5.03% in intraday trading on Tuesday, defying a price target reduction as investors focus on a maintained positive outlook from a major Wall Street firm. The stock's resilience in the face of mixed analyst actions highlights the market's optimistic view on the company's prospects.
Wells Fargo has reiterated its Overweight rating on Golden Entertainment, signaling continued confidence in the company's performance and future outlook. This maintained positive stance appears to be the primary driver behind the stock's significant uptick. However, it's worth noting that the same analyst has simultaneously lowered the price target for GDEN from $36 to $34, a move that would typically exert downward pressure on a stock.
The market's strong positive reaction, despite the price target reduction, suggests that investors are placing more weight on the maintained Overweight rating. This response indicates a belief that Golden Entertainment's fundamental strength and growth potential remain intact, even if near-term price expectations have been slightly tempered.
